Summer.Batch.Extra.Sort.IRecordAccessorFactory< T > Interface Template Reference

Factory interface for creating instances of IRecordReader<T> and IRecordWriter<T>. More...

Public Member Functions

IRecordReader< T > CreateReader (Stream stream)
 Creates a new IRecordReader<T>. More...
 
IRecordWriter< T > CreateWriter (Stream stream)
 Creates a new IRecordWriter<T>. More...
 

Detailed Description

Factory interface for creating instances of IRecordReader<T> and IRecordWriter<T>.

Template Parameters
T 

Member Function Documentation

IRecordReader<T> Summer.Batch.Extra.Sort.IRecordAccessorFactory< T >.CreateReader ( Stream  stream)

Creates a new IRecordReader<T>.

Parameters
streamthe stream to read from
Returns
a new IRecordReader<T>
IRecordWriter<T> Summer.Batch.Extra.Sort.IRecordAccessorFactory< T >.CreateWriter ( Stream  stream)

Creates a new IRecordWriter<T>.

Parameters
streamthe stream to write to
Returns
a new IRecordWriter<T>

The documentation for this interface was generated from the following file:
  • Summer.Batch.Extra/Sort/IRecordAccessorFactory.cs